This is an exciting opportunity for a talented media professional to join Capital One’s Brand Media Department as an Associate, serving as an internal subject matter expert responsible for paid media strategy, planning and activation of media investment for Brand and assigned Lines of Businesses (LOB’s). The ideal candidate will have studied marketing or advertising with a passion for paid media. You will be responsible for ensuring that media plans align with the overall marketing strategy and deliver on Brand objectives. Role also includes management of external Agency partners. This position is responsible for paid media programs, not earned media or public relations.
Responsibilities:
Collaborate with Brand Strategy, Advertising, Sponsorships, Social and Marketing & Analysis teams to develop integrated marketing campaigns
Support Brand, product and Sponsorship campaigns across mass media channels including video, print, audio, digital, social and OOH platforms
Support in developing paid media plans that drive innovation and impact by incorporating new channels and using traditional channels in unique ways
Support in evaluating research, develop points of view and craft paid media strategies and tactics to address business objectives
Support Brand and LOB (line of business) media plan execution and maintenance; manage media authorizations, flowcharts, and plan actualizations
Manage paid media campaign budgets, including reconciliation and reporting
Develop solid understanding of financial services competitive category; stay current with media trends and identify opportunity areas
Build strong agency partner and media vendor relationships
Track, benchmark and report on key performance metrics

BASIC QUALIFICATIONS:
Bachelor’s Degree or Military Experience
At least 1 year of experience in paid media, advertising or marketing
P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S:
Experience in managing paid media campaign budgets
General understanding of media principles, planning and buying functions
Experience with media tools including but not limited to MRI, Simmons, Scarborough, Nielsen, and comScore
Experience in Credit Card, Bank or other Financial Services industries
Strong communication and project prioritization skills
